About Katherine H. Saunders

Katherine H. Saunders is a scholar working on Pharmacology, Pharmacy and Physiology, having authored 35 papers that have together received 854 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pharmacology and Obesity Treatment (22 papers), Diet and metabolism studies (20 papers) and Bariatric Surgery and Outcomes (10 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pharmacy (97 citations), Physiology (394 citations) and Pharmacology (246 citations). Katherine H. Saunders has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Lebanon and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Leon I. Igel, Louis J. Aronne, Rekha B. Kumar, Alpana P. Shukla, Beverly G. Tchang, Lawrence J. Cheskin, Marina Kurian, Sarah E. Barlow, Andrés Acosta and Sarah E. Streett. Their work appears in journals such as Gastroenterology, Diabetes and Clinical Gastroenterology and Hepatology.
